{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,12,10]],"date-time":"2025-12-10T08:45:58Z","timestamp":1765356358855,"version":"3.28.0"},"reference-count":38,"publisher":"IEEE","content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2017,7]]},"DOI":"10.1109\/samos.2017.8344645","type":"proceedings-article","created":{"date-parts":[[2018,4,23]],"date-time":"2018-04-23T19:33:43Z","timestamp":1524512023000},"page":"308-316","source":"Crossref","is-referenced-by-count":11,"title":["The ANTAREX tool flow for monitoring and autotuning energy efficient HPC systems"],"prefix":"10.1109","author":[{"given":"Cristina","family":"Silvano","sequence":"first","affiliation":[]},{"given":"Giovanni","family":"Agosta","sequence":"additional","affiliation":[]},{"given":"Jorge","family":"Barbosa","sequence":"additional","affiliation":[]},{"given":"Andrea","family":"Bartolini","sequence":"additional","affiliation":[]},{"given":"Andrea R.","family":"Beccari","sequence":"additional","affiliation":[]},{"given":"Luca","family":"Benini","sequence":"additional","affiliation":[]},{"given":"Joao","family":"Bispo","sequence":"additional","affiliation":[]},{"given":"Joao M.P.","family":"Cardoso","sequence":"additional","affiliation":[]},{"given":"Carlo","family":"Cavazzoni","sequence":"additional","affiliation":[]},{"given":"Stefano","family":"Cherubin","sequence":"additional","affiliation":[]},{"given":"Radim","family":"Cmar","sequence":"additional","affiliation":[]},{"given":"Davide","family":"Gadioli","sequence":"additional","affiliation":[]},{"given":"Candida","family":"Manelfi","sequence":"additional","affiliation":[]},{"given":"Jan","family":"Martinovic","sequence":"additional","affiliation":[]},{"given":"Ricardo","family":"Nobre","sequence":"additional","affiliation":[]},{"given":"Gianluca","family":"Palermo","sequence":"additional","affiliation":[]},{"given":"Martin","family":"Palkovic","sequence":"additional","affiliation":[]},{"given":"Pedro","family":"Pinto","sequence":"additional","affiliation":[]},{"given":"Erven","family":"Rohou","sequence":"additional","affiliation":[]},{"given":"Nico","family":"Sanna","sequence":"additional","affiliation":[]},{"given":"Katerina","family":"Slaninova","sequence":"additional","affiliation":[]}],"member":"263","reference":[{"key":"ref38","article-title":"A context-aware primitive for nested recursive parallelism","author":"jordan","year":"2016","journal-title":"IWMSE Workshop ser Euro-Par 2016"},{"key":"ref33","first-page":"626","article-title":"Application-independent autotuning for gpus","author":"tillmann","year":"2013","journal-title":"PARCO"},{"key":"ref32","first-page":"178","author":"tiwari","year":"2011","journal-title":"Auto-tuning for Energy Usage in Scientific Applications"},{"key":"ref31","article-title":"Energy Auto-tuning using the Polyhedral Approach","author":"wang","year":"2014","journal-title":"Proceedings of the 4th International Workshop on Polyhedral Compilation Techniques"},{"key":"ref30","doi-asserted-by":"publisher","DOI":"10.1109\/SC.2012.97"},{"key":"ref37","doi-asserted-by":"publisher","DOI":"10.1109\/MTAGS.2016.06"},{"key":"ref36","doi-asserted-by":"publisher","DOI":"10.23919\/DATE.2017.7926967"},{"key":"ref35","doi-asserted-by":"publisher","DOI":"10.1145\/1961296.1950390"},{"key":"ref34","doi-asserted-by":"publisher","DOI":"10.1145\/2954680.2872402"},{"key":"ref10","doi-asserted-by":"publisher","DOI":"10.1109\/CANDAR.2014.53"},{"key":"ref11","article-title":"OpenCL Performance Portability for General-purpose Computation on Graphics Processor Units: an Exploration on Cryptographic Primitives","author":"agosta","year":"2014","journal-title":"Concurrency and Computation Practice and Experience"},{"journal-title":"Iterative Compilation in a Non-linear Optimisation Space","year":"1998","author":"bodin","key":"ref12"},{"key":"ref13","doi-asserted-by":"publisher","DOI":"10.1145\/1837274.1837303"},{"key":"ref14","doi-asserted-by":"publisher","DOI":"10.1145\/2751559"},{"key":"ref15","doi-asserted-by":"publisher","DOI":"10.1038\/218019a0"},{"key":"ref16","doi-asserted-by":"publisher","DOI":"10.1109\/ASAP.2014.6868651"},{"key":"ref17","doi-asserted-by":"publisher","DOI":"10.7873\/DATE.2015.0125"},{"key":"ref18","doi-asserted-by":"publisher","DOI":"10.1109\/SAMOS.2015.7363673"},{"key":"ref19","doi-asserted-by":"publisher","DOI":"10.1109\/IGCC.2013.6604520"},{"key":"ref28","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-540-69330-7_10"},{"key":"ref4","article-title":"Intel&#x00AE; Xeon Phi&#x2122; Coprocessor-the Architecture","author":"chrysos","year":"2014","journal-title":"Intel Whitepaper"},{"key":"ref27","article-title":"Improving performance with integrated program transformations","author":"qasem","year":"2003","journal-title":"Technical Report Manuscript"},{"key":"ref3","doi-asserted-by":"publisher","DOI":"10.1145\/2903150.2903470"},{"key":"ref6","article-title":"Performance-driven instrumentation and mapping strategies using the LARA aspect-oriented programming approach","author":"cardoso","year":"2014","journal-title":"Software Practice and Experience"},{"key":"ref29","doi-asserted-by":"publisher","DOI":"10.1109\/IPDPS.2009.5161004"},{"key":"ref5","doi-asserted-by":"publisher","DOI":"10.1145\/2162049.2162071"},{"key":"ref8","doi-asserted-by":"publisher","DOI":"10.1016\/j.micpro.2013.06.001"},{"key":"ref7","doi-asserted-by":"crossref","first-page":"220","DOI":"10.1007\/BFb0053381","article-title":"Aspect-oriented Programming","volume":"1241","author":"irwin","year":"1997","journal-title":"ECOOP'97-Object-Oriented Programming ser Lecture Notes in Computer Science"},{"key":"ref2","doi-asserted-by":"publisher","DOI":"10.1109\/CSE.2015.58"},{"key":"ref9","doi-asserted-by":"publisher","DOI":"10.1145\/2764967.2764978"},{"key":"ref1","article-title":"HPC and Big Data","volume":"12","author":"curley","year":"2014","journal-title":"Innovation"},{"key":"ref20","doi-asserted-by":"publisher","DOI":"10.1145\/2627369.2627659"},{"key":"ref22","doi-asserted-by":"publisher","DOI":"10.1109\/HPCSim.2015.7237025"},{"key":"ref21","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-319-07518-1_25"},{"key":"ref24","article-title":"A programming language interface to describe transformations and code generation","author":"rudy","year":"2010","journal-title":"International Workshop on Languages and Compilers for Parallel Computing"},{"key":"ref23","doi-asserted-by":"publisher","DOI":"10.23919\/DATE.2017.7927143"},{"key":"ref26","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-662-53413-7_19"},{"key":"ref25","doi-asserted-by":"publisher","DOI":"10.1002\/spe.1089"}],"event":{"name":"2017 International Conference on Embedded Computer Systems: Architectures, Modeling, and Simulation (SAMOS)","start":{"date-parts":[[2017,7,17]]},"location":"Pythagorion","end":{"date-parts":[[2017,7,20]]}},"container-title":["2017 International Conference on Embedded Computer Systems: Architectures, Modeling, and Simulation (SAMOS)"],"original-title":[],"link":[{"URL":"http:\/\/xplorestaging.ieee.org\/ielx7\/8337645\/8344598\/08344645.pdf?arnumber=8344645","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,10,16]],"date-time":"2019-10-16T18:41:49Z","timestamp":1571251309000},"score":1,"resource":{"primary":{"URL":"https:\/\/ieeexplore.ieee.org\/document\/8344645\/"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2017,7]]},"references-count":38,"URL":"https:\/\/doi.org\/10.1109\/samos.2017.8344645","relation":{},"subject":[],"published":{"date-parts":[[2017,7]]}}}